dc.description.abstractConsistency and setting time is an important parameter of the harden concrete. The pulpous of this study is to compare the above mentioned parameter, as a partial replacement of cement with silica fume (SF)/metakaoline (MK) ranging from 0 to 15% at an interval of 2.5%. The normal consistency of cement (OPC) is 30.5% and for 15% SF replacement is 37% and for 15% MF replacement is 36.37% as the maximum values. It is inferred that increase in the replacement level of admixtures increases the water demand. The initial setting time (IST) and the final setting time (FST) for cement (OPC) replaced with 15% SF are 240 and 285 minutes and for 15% MK are 260 and 305 minutes respectively.en_US
